Rebecca R. McIntosh is a scholar working on Ecology, Nature and Landscape Conservation and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ics. According to data from OpenAlex, Rebecca R. McIntosh has authored 34 papers receiving a total of 627 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 30 papers in Ecology, 11 papers in Nature and Landscape Conservation and 8 papers in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ics. Recurrent topics in Rebecca R. McIntosh’s work include Marine animal studies overview (22 papers), Avian ecology and behavior (8 papers) and Cephalopods and Marine Biology (7 papers). Rebecca R. McIntosh is often cited by papers focused on Marine animal studies overview (22 papers), Avian ecology and behavior (8 papers) and Cephalopods and Marine Biology (7 papers). Rebecca R. McIntosh collaborates with scholars based in Australia, United States and France. Rebecca R. McIntosh's co-authors include Simon D. Goldsworthy, Brad Page, Peter Dann, P. D. Shaughnessy, Alastair M. M. Baylis, Duncan R. Sutherland, Jane McKenzie, Roger Kirkwood, A.D. Morrissey and M.R.J. Salton and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, The Science of The Total Environment and Biological reviews/Biological reviews of the Cambridge Philosophical Society.
